Why should you give?

Christians [People] are called to give generously because it reflects God's nature and pleases Him. In the Old Testament, Proverbs 11:25 states, "A generous person will prosper; whoever refreshes others will be refreshed." This highlights the principle of sowing and reaping, indicating that giving leads to blessings. Malachi 3:10 emphasizes the importance of tithing, stating that God will open the floodgates of heaven and pour out so much blessing that there will not be room enough to store it.

In the New Testament, Jesus teaches about giving in Matthew 6:3-4, saying, "But when you give to the needy, do not let your left hand know what your right hand is doing, so that your giving may be in secret. Then your Father, who sees what is done in secret, will reward you." This underscores the importance of humility in giving. 2 Corinthians 9:7 encourages cheerful giving, stating that God loves a cheerful giver. Overall, giving is not only an act of obedience but also a demonstration of love, faith, and trust in God's provision and promises.
